Short Session Deadlines
All summer sessions follow short-session scheduling guidelines. Check MySWC to view the following deadline dates by clicking on the class title of a specific class section. Deadlines for short-session classes are determined as indicated below:
- Deadline to add classes: Day prior to Census
- Deadline for refund: 10% of actual meeting days (Note: in some cases, this may be the first day of class)
- Deadline to apply for pass/no pass option is the first week for short term classes
- Deadline to withdraw from class without receiving a "W": 20% of actual class meeting days
- Deadline to withdraw from class and receive a "W": 75% of actual meeting days
